#2c61d3 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2c61d3 is composed of 17.3% red, 38% green and 82.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 79.1% cyan, 54% magenta, 0% yellow and 17.3% black. It has a hue angle of 221 degrees, a saturation of 65.5% and a lightness of 50%. #2c61d3 color hex could be obtained by blending #58c2ff with #0000a7.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

#2c61d3 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2c61d3 has RGB values of R:44, G:97, B:211 and CMYK values of C:0.79, M:0.54, Y:0,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 2908627.

Shades and Tints of #2c61d3
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030710 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.
